The word प्रतीक्षालय (Pratīkṣālaya) is a formal and descriptive Hindi noun that translates directly to 'waiting room' in English. It is a compound word derived from two Sanskrit roots: pratīkṣā (waiting/expectation) and ālaya (abode/place/house). Understanding this word provides a window into how Hindi constructs formal terminology by combining conceptual roots with locational suffixes. In the context of modern India, this word is most frequently encountered in public infrastructure settings such as railway stations, airports, hospitals, and government offices. While the English term 'waiting room' is widely understood and used in urban 'Hinglish' conversations, प्रतीक्षालय remains the standard designation on official signage and in formal announcements. It evokes a specific atmosphere of transition—the hum of fans, the rustle of newspapers, and the collective patience of travelers. When you use this word, you are operating in a register that is respectful and precise, moving beyond basic survival Hindi into the realm of administrative and formal social interaction.

Etymological Breakdown
The prefix 'Prati' indicates 'towards' or 'against', and 'Iksha' relates to 'seeing' or 'looking'. Thus, 'Pratiksha' is the act of looking forward to something. 'Alaya' is a common suffix for buildings, similar to 'Himalaya' (Abode of Snow) or 'Vidyalaya' (Abode of Knowledge).

Beyond its literal meaning, the word carries a cultural weight. In India, railway waiting rooms are often categorized by class (General, Sleeper, AC) or gender (Ladies' Waiting Room). Using the term प्रतीक्षालय helps a traveler navigate these social layers. For instance, asking for the 'Mahila Pratīkṣālaya' (Ladies' Waiting Room) is a crucial safety and comfort phrase for female travelers. In medical contexts, the word transitions from the bustle of travel to the anxiety of healthcare, where families wait for news. The word is inherently masculine in gender, which affects the adjectives and verbs associated with it. For example, one would say 'Bada Pratīkṣālaya' (Big waiting room) rather than 'Badi'. Using प्रतीक्षालय correctly involves understanding its grammatical gender and how it interacts with postpositions. As a masculine noun ending in 'a' (the schwa sound), it follows standard declension patterns. In its direct form, it is 'प्रतीक्षालय', but when followed by a postposition like 'mein' (in), 'se' (from), or 'ko' (to), it remains 'प्रतीक्षालय' in the singular but changes to 'प्रतीक्षालयों' in the plural. For example, 'Pratīkṣālaya mein' (in the waiting room) versus 'Pratīkṣālayoṃ mein' (in the waiting rooms). This distinction is vital for intermediate learners aiming for grammatical precision. The word is often the subject of sentences describing location or state, frequently paired with the verb 'hona' (to be) or 'baithna' (to sit).

Common Verb Pairings
1. Pratīkṣālaya mein rukna (To stay in the waiting room). 2. Pratīkṣālaya dhoondhna (To look for the waiting room). 3. Pratīkṣālaya ka upyog karna (To use the waiting room).

क्या इस स्टेशन पर कोई वातानुकूलित प्रतीक्षालय है? (Is there any air-conditioned waiting room at this station?)

When constructing sentences, pay attention to the adjectives. Since the word is masculine, adjectives must agree. 'Saaf-suthra pratīkṣālaya' (clean waiting room) uses the masculine 'a' ending. If you were to use a feminine word like 'jagah' (place), it would be 'saaf-suthri jagah'. This makes प्रतीक्षालय an excellent practice word for adjective-noun agreement. Furthermore, in formal writing, you might see it used as part of a longer compound, such as 'yatri pratīkṣālaya' (passenger waiting room). In such cases, 'yatri' acts as a modifier. Understanding these structures allows you to parse complex signs in public spaces.

In more advanced usage, the word can appear in passive constructions. 'Pratīkṣālaya ko naya banaya gaya hai' (The waiting room has been renovated/made new). Here, the focus is on the room as an object of action. In literary Hindi, one might describe the 'sunsaan pratīkṣālaya' (desolate waiting room) to set a mood of loneliness or anticipation. The most common place to hear प्रतीक्षालय is through the crackling loudspeakers of an Indian Railway station. Announcements often direct passengers to these areas during train delays. 'Yatriyon se nivedan hai ki ve pratīkṣālaya ka upyog karein' (Passengers are requested to use the waiting room). These announcements are a hallmark of the Indian travel experience, and recognizing this word can save you from standing on a crowded platform for hours. You will also hear it in large government hospitals, where 'Pratīkṣālaya' signs point the way for relatives of patients. In these settings, the word is spoken with a sense of authority and direction, helping to manage large crowds in high-stress environments.

अगली घोषणा तक कृपया प्रतीक्षालय में बैठें। (Please sit in the waiting room until the next announcement.)

In television dramas or films, particularly those set in small towns or involving travel, the प्रतीक्षालय often serves as a backdrop for chance encounters. Characters might meet and share their life stories while waiting for a delayed bus or train. In these contexts, the word is used to establish a setting of temporary community. You might also hear it in news reports discussing the modernization of public facilities. A reporter might say, 'Station par naye pratīkṣālaya ka udghatan hua' (A new waiting room was inaugurated at the station). This reinforces the word's status as a standard term in the public lexicon, used by journalists and officials alike to describe civic improvements.

Finally, in the corporate world, though 'reception' or 'lobby' are common, formal Hindi invitations or office directories might still use प्रतीक्षालय or प्रतीक्षा-कक्ष. For example, a receptionist might say, 'Kripya pratīkṣālaya mein virajiye' (Please be seated in the waiting room). The use of 'virajiye' (a very formal way to say 'sit') paired with 'pratīkṣālaya' creates a highly polite and professional atmosphere. One of the most frequent mistakes learners make with प्रतीक्षालय is misidentifying its gender. Many Hindi learners assume that because 'pratīkṣā' (waiting) is feminine, the compound word 'pratīkṣālaya' must also be feminine. However, in Hindi compound words ending in '-ālaya', the gender is determined by the final component. 'Alaya' is masculine, so 'pratīkṣālaya' is masculine. Saying 'Badi pratīkṣālaya' is a common error; the correct form is 'Bada pratīkṣālaya'. Another common mistake is related to pronunciation, specifically the conjunct consonant 'ksha' (क्ष). Many beginners pronounce it as a simple 'sha' or 'kha', but it is a combination of 'k' and 'sh'. Incorrect pronunciation can make the word unrecognizable to native speakers, especially in noisy environments like stations.

Common Gender Errors
Incorrect: Yeh pratīkṣālaya acchi hai. (Feminine agreement). Correct: Yeh pratīkṣālaya accha hai. (Masculine agreement).

गलत: प्रतीक्षालय भरी हुई है। (Wrong: The waiting room is full - feminine). सही: प्रतीक्षालय भरा हुआ है। (Correct: The waiting room is full - masculine).

Spelling is another area where learners struggle. The word uses the 'ee' (ई) matra after 'p' and 'r', and the 'aa' (ा) matra after 'sh'. Writing it as 'Pratikshalay' (with a short 'i') is a common misspelling in Devanagari (प्रतिक्षालय instead of प्रतीक्षालय). While the difference might seem minor, it affects the vowel length and the overall 'feel' of the word. Additionally, learners often confuse प्रतीक्षालय with विश्रामालय (Vishrāmālaya - restroom/waiting hall). While they are similar, a 'Vishrāmālaya' is specifically for resting or sleeping, whereas a 'Pratīkṣālaya' is strictly for waiting. Using the wrong one might lead you to a room with beds when you just wanted a chair.

Finally, avoid overusing the word in informal settings. If you are at a friend's house and waiting in their living room, calling it a 'pratīkṣālaya' would sound unnaturally formal or even sarcastic. In a home, you would use 'baithak' (living room). Use 'pratīkṣālaya' for public, institutional, or formal contexts. Misapplying the register (the level of formality) is a subtle mistake that separates intermediate learners from advanced ones. While प्रतीक्षालय is the standard formal term, Hindi offers several alternatives depending on the context and desired formality. The most common informal alternative is simply using the English phrase 'Waiting Room'. In urban India, you are more likely to hear someone say, 'Waiting room mein milte hain' (Let's meet in the waiting room) than the pure Hindi version. However, for formal writing and reading signs, you must know the Hindi term. Another close relative is प्रतीक्षा-कक्ष (Pratīkṣā-kakṣ). This is often used for smaller rooms, like those in a doctor's clinic or a private office. While 'Alaya' implies a larger 'abode' or hall, 'Kaksh' specifically means 'room' or 'chamber'.

Comparison Table
  • प्रतीक्षालय: Formal, large public spaces (Stations, Airports).
  • प्रतीक्षा-कक्ष: Semi-formal, smaller rooms (Offices, Clinics).
  • इंतज़ारगाह (Intezaar-gah): Urdu-influenced, poetic or old-fashioned.
  • विश्रामालय (Vishrāmālaya): Specifically for resting/sleeping.

स्टेशन पर विश्रामालय और प्रतीक्षालय दोनों अलग-अलग हैं। (At the station, the rest room and waiting room are both separate.)

For those interested in the Urdu influence on Hindi, इंतज़ारगाह (Intezaar-gah) is a beautiful alternative. 'Intezaar' means waiting, and 'gah' is a suffix for place (like 'Dargah'). You might find this in literature or in regions with a strong Urdu heritage like Lucknow or Hyderabad. However, it is rarely used in official government signage today. Another word to be aware of is लॉबी (Lobby), used in hotels and modern corporate offices. While a lobby is a type of waiting area, it serves a broader social and entrance function. Knowing when to use 'Lobby' versus 'Pratīkṣālaya' shows a deep understanding of modern Indian social settings.

In summary, while प्रतीक्षालय is the king of formal signage, your choice of word should reflect your surroundings. Use 'Waiting room' for casual talk, 'Pratīkṣā-kakṣ' for a doctor's office, and 'Pratīkṣālaya' when you are reading a sign at the New Delhi Railway Station or writing a formal letter.
